Don't want to let it get to that point. You had a different situation then. Brand new coach hand picked by Ronald Corey. You had the star go to corey and basically say him or me Corey had a huge ego and couldn't admit he made a mistake in the coach and so traded the player. Even when Roy went back on his demand two days after the detroit game, he still insisted and traded him. This is different. We all know therrien is done by mid april when the season ends, i don't see subban getting into a him or me stance cause subban is smart enough to recognize that. And even if Subban did get into the him or me stance, firing a coach after 4 years and a disastrous season isn't going to be an ego crushing move like Corey firing Tremblay would have been.
